Phoenix SACB Series Industrial Pre-Assembled Cables Selection Guide

Opening: Reliable Pre-Assembled Connectivity for Industrial Automation & Sensor Networks

The Phoenix SACB series represents industrial-grade pre-assembled cables engineered for seamless connectivity in automation systems, sensor/actuator networks, and industrial control applications. Covering diverse configurations—multi-core power/signal combinations (e.g., 16X0.5/3X1.0), fixed-interface connections (M12/M8/M16), straight-through cables, and specialized variants (QO-coded, heavy-duty HD)—these cables feature durable PUR/VPUR jackets, flexible core counts (8/10/12/16-core), precise wire gauges (0.34mm²–1.0mm²), and industrial-grade shielding. Designed for harsh factory environments, machine-to-control cabinet wiring, and high-vibration applications, they ensure plug-and-play deployment, reliable signal/power transmission, and long-term durability.


I. Core Advantages of the Series

  1. Structural Diversity for Targeted Applications

    • Multi-core power/signal integration: Combinations like 16X0.5/3X1.0 (16 signal cores + 3 power cores) for simultaneous signal transmission and power supply, eliminating separate wiring;
    • Fixed-interface flexibility: M12/M8/M16 connector combinations (e.g., M12-M8, M16-M8) for direct sensor/actuator-to-controller connections;
    • Length versatility: 5m–200m coverage, from cabinet-internal short links (5m) to cross-workshop long-distance wiring (200m);
    • Specialized variants: Heavy-duty (HD) for vibration-prone environments, QO-coded for industrial Ethernet, and PTP (point-to-point) for dedicated device links.
  2. Industrial-Grade Durability & Environmental Resistance

    • Jacket materials: PUR (polyurethane) for oil, abrasion, and chemical resistance; VPUR (weather-resistant PUR) for outdoor or extreme-temperature use;
    • Wide operating temperature range: -40°C to +85°C, suitable for harsh indoor/outdoor industrial conditions;
    • Shielding (SH suffix): Braided shielding suppresses EMI/RFI interference from inverters, motors, and power lines, ensuring signal integrity;
    • Robust connectors: Gold-plated contacts with ≥10,000 mating cycles, IP67 protection (when mated) against dust and moisture.
  3. Plug-and-Play Efficiency & Installation Ease

    • Pre-assembled, factory-terminated design eliminates on-site stripping, crimping, and testing, reducing installation time by up to 80%;
    • Tool-free locking mechanisms (twist-lock) for secure, quick connections;
    • Color-coded or coded connectors (QO) for error-free identification and mating;
    • Compatibility with Phoenix and third-party industrial sensors, PLCs, and actuators.
  4. Precise Performance Matching

    • Wire gauge options (0.34mm²/0.5mm²/0.75mm²/1.0mm²) for targeted current-carrying capacity (0.34mm² for signal, 1.0mm² for power);
    • Core count combinations (8/10/12/16-core) to match multi-channel sensor/actuator requirements;
    • Heavy-duty (HD) construction for mechanical stress resistance in drag chains or mobile equipment.

III. Nomenclature Decoding: Understanding the Part Number System

SACB-[Core Configuration/Wire Gauge]-[Length]-[Interface/Type]-[Material/Special Features]

  • SACB: Product series identifier (industrial pre-assembled cables).
  • Core Configuration/Wire Gauge:
    • Multi-core combination: [Main Core Count]X[Wire Gauge]/[Auxiliary Core Count]X[Wire Gauge] (e.g., 16X0,5/3X1,0 = 16 cores × 0.5mm² + 3 cores × 1.0mm²);
    • Fixed core count: [Core Count]/[Poles] (e.g., 10/3 = 10 cores, 3 poles);
    • Straight-through: [Input Core Count]-[Output Core Count] (e.g., 8-16 = 8→16 core expansion).
  • Length: Specified in meters (e.g., 50 = 50m, 200,0 = 200m); "L" = long-length optimized.
  • Interface/Type:
    • Fixed interfaces: M12/M8/M16 (e.g., M12-M8 = M12 male → M8 male);
    • Special types: PTP (point-to-point), C (coded), SC (signal connector), Straight-through;
    • Poles: Number of active contacts (e.g., 4 = 4-pole connection).
  • Material/Special Features:
    • Jacket: PUR (polyurethane), VPUR (weather-resistant PUR);
    • Shielding: SH = shielded (braided EMI protection);
    • Special features: HD (heavy-duty), QO (PROFINET-coded), GG (color-coded), L (long-length optimized).

IV. 3-Step Quick Selection Technique

Step 1: Select Cable Type Based on Application

  • Simultaneous signal + power: Choose multi-core power/signal cables (e.g., 1539156/1503373) with core/wire gauge matching signal channels and power requirements.
  • Direct sensor/controller connection: Opt for fixed-interface cables (e.g., 1434853/1197576) with matching connector types (M12/M8/M16) of your devices.
  • General-purpose signal transmission: Pick straight-through cables (e.g., 1695184/1695210) for simple 8/16-core signal links.
  • PROFINET industrial Ethernet: Select QO-coded cables (1548435) for protocol compliance.
  • Harsh/vibration-prone environments: Choose HD (heavy-duty) variants (e.g., 1197576/1197325) for enhanced durability.

Step 2: Match Core Count, Wire Gauge & Length

  • Core count:
    • Small-scale (≤8 devices): 8-core variants (e.g., 1503357/1695184);
    • Medium-scale (9-12 devices): 12-core variants (e.g., 1503360);
    • Large-scale (13-16 devices): 16-core variants (e.g., 1539156/1559893).
  • Wire gauge:
    • Signal-only (low current): 0.34mm² variants (e.g., 1517602/1548435);
    • Signal + low-power supply: 0.5mm² variants (e.g., 1503373/1695184);
    • Signal + medium-power supply: 0.75mm²/1.0mm² variants (e.g., 1539350/1539156).
  • Length:
    • Cabinet-internal/short-distance (≤5m): 5m variants (e.g., 1516072/1197325);
    • Machine-to-machine (6-50m): 50m variants (e.g., 1503373/1539156);
    • Cross-workshop (≥100m): 200m variant (1559893) or cascaded 50m cables.

Step 3: Choose Material & Special Features

  • Outdoor/extreme weather: Select VPUR jacket (1430938) for UV, moisture, and temperature resistance.
  • High-interference environments (inverters/motors): Opt for SH (shielded) variants (1539156) to suppress EMI.
  • Error-free installation: Pick coded (C/QO) or color-coded (GG) variants (e.g., 1197623/1548435) for quick identification.
  • Mobile equipment/drag chains: Choose HD (heavy-duty) variants (e.g., 1197576/1197625) for mechanical stress resistance.
  • PROFINET compliance: Mandatory QO-coded variant (1548435) for seamless integration with industrial Ethernet networks.

VI. Selection Pitfall Avoidance Guide

  1. Core Count Mismatch: 16 sensors using 8-core cables → Select 16-core variants (1539156/1559893) to avoid insufficient channels.
  2. Wire Gauge Underestimation: Powering 1.0A actuators with 0.34mm² cables → Choose 0.75mm²/1.0mm² variants (1539350/1539156) for adequate current capacity.
  3. Outdoor Use with Standard PUR: Outdoor applications using non-VPUR cables → Select VPUR variant (1430938) to resist UV and moisture.
  4. Shielding Neglect: High-interference environments using non-SH cables → Opt for shielded variants (1539156) to prevent signal distortion.
  5. Interface Incompatibility: M12 controllers using M16-M8 cables → Match connector types (e.g., 1434853 for M12-M8) to ensure physical mating.
  6. Length Overestimation/Underestimation: 10m required distance using 50m cables → Choose appropriate length (e.g., 10m variant 1197328) to avoid excess cable or tension.
  7. PROFINET Projects Using Non-QO Cables: Protocol compliance failures → Use QO-coded variant (1548435) for seamless PROFINET integration.
  8. Mobile Equipment Using Standard Cables: Drag chain applications with non-HD cables → Select HD variants (1197576/1197625) for mechanical stress resistance.
